AV62 TGZ is a 2012 Toyota Aygo in Black with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.1%.
Across all 2012 Toyota Aygo models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.9% with a typical mileage of 46,076 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Aygo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 33,372 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AV62 TGZ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Aygo typ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 14 years old, this Toyota Aygo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
